Output d5ce9664305bc62637790ef16407561ff2bc2f0bba3fa1724e5218bce4cfa71a:10

value
8546076
script pubkey
OP_0 OP_PUSHBYTES_20 f7cec82b3ee0cc2659d2b0424fd0ce62a36c9e81
address
bc1q7l8vs2e7urxzvkwjkppyl5xwv23ke85pnr5fy2
transaction
d5ce9664305bc62637790ef16407561ff2bc2f0bba3fa1724e5218bce4cfa71a
confirmations
276
spent
true